Memphis Pastor Shot in Church Parking Lot Trying to Stop Car Theft

A Memphis pastor was shot in the parking lot of his church Sunday morning when he tried to stop thugs from stealing a Sunday school teacher’s car.

Memphis Police say the shooting happened at New Zionfield Baptist Church at 9:13 a.m.

Pastor Clemmie Livingston, Jr., 70, was rushed to Regional One Hospital in critical condition, television station WREG reported. He was shot in the face.

“Just sad and ridiculous the church ain’t even safe from crime,” wrote one furious Memphian on social media.

Memphis Police say they are searching for two black men wearing hoodies. Anyone with information should call CrimeStoppers at 901-528-CASH.
